A Brief Introduction to Licorice
Licorice, derived from the roots of the Glycyrrhiza glabra plant, has been cherished for centuries. The sweet component, glycyrrhizin, is about 50 times sweeter than sugar! Historically, it was used in ancient civilizations for medicinal purposes and as a flavoring agent. Today, it remains a staple in many cultures, often found in candies, herbal teas, and even skincare products.

The Medicinal Marvels of Licorice
Hold on to your hats, folks! Licorice isn't just a treat for your taste buds; it's also packed with health benefits. Traditionally, it has been used in herbal medicine to alleviate sore throats, reduce inflammation, and even support respiratory health. Some studies suggest that licorice may help with stomach ulcers and digestive issues. However, it's essential to consult with a healthcare professional before diving into licorice remedies, especially if you have underlying health conditions.

Licorice in Skincare: A Sweet Surprise
Who would've thought that licorice could find a home in your skincare routine? This ingredient is gaining popularity for its anti-inflammatory and skin-brightening properties. Many skincare products now feature licorice extract to help even out skin tone and reduce redness. It's like having a little piece of candy for your skin—sweet, right?
